What companies run services between Bermondsey, England and Highgate Cemetery, England?

You can take a subway from Bermondsey station to Highgate Cemetery via Waterloo station and Archway station in around 40 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Southwark Park Rd/St James Rd to Highgate Cemetery via Camden Town Station, Kentish Town Road Camden Town, and Oakeshott Avenue in around 1h 18m.
